Exquisite, brand new, brilliant, and uncirculated 2023 issue 1 gram Chinese Panda gold bullion coins. These coins are issued by the Chinese Mint, and are part of their Panda series. The Panda series was first issued in gold in 1982. The coin was hailed as a success, and in 1983 the coin was also released in silver. In 2021, the Panda coin debuted in platinum as well. The original Panda coins were issued in extremely limited mintages, and this helped to increase the demand for the coins, but also to boost their numismatic value over time.
The Panda series was released in ounce denominations until 2016, when the coin's denomination was updated to grams. Today, the gold Panda series is available in 1 gram, 3 gram, 8 gram, 15 gram, and 30 gram sizes.
These coins feature an image of Beijing's Temple of Heaven on the front. The coin's year of minting, 2023, can be found at the bottom of the coin. The reverse side of the coin features an image of two Pandas in a tree reaching towards each other. The coin's weight of 1 gram, and purity of 999 are also located on the outside of the image. These coins have a face value of 10 Yuan, which is imprinted on the bottom of the coin. Each year, the image of the Panda is updated on these coins. This has given them some collectible value over the investment gold value of the coin.
